An Act concerning a cable television service outage toll-free telephone number and supplementing Title 48 of the Revised Statutes.

 

     Be It Enacted by the Senate and General Assembly of the State of New Jersey:

 

     1.    a.   A cable television company shall establish and maintain a toll-free telephone number that may be used by its customers to report CATV service outages, to receive updates concerning the status of CATV service outages, and to receive information concerning the resumption of CATV service, which shall include, but not be limited to, an estimated time of CATV service restoration.

     b.    A cable television company shall publish the toll-free telephone number required, pursuant to subsection a. of this section, with an explanation of the purpose of the toll-free telephone number, on every periodic bill sent to each customer of the cable television company and in a prominent location on the homepage of the cable television company's Internet website.

 

     2.    This act shall take effect immediately but shall remain inoperative for 60 days following the date of enactment.

 

 

STATEMENT

 

     This bill requires a cable television (CATV) company to establish and maintain a toll-free telephone number that may be used by its customers to report CATV service outages, to receive updates concerning the status of CATV service outages, and to receive information concerning the resumption of CATV service, which shall include, but not be limited to, an estimated time of CATV service restoration.

     Under the bill, a CATV company is to publish the toll-free telephone number, with an explanation of the purpose of the toll-free telephone number, on every periodic bill sent to each customer of the cable television company and in a prominent location on the homepage of the CATV company's Internet website.
